Bug description:
  As part of programming OpenvSwitch, Neutron will add to which
  protocols bridges support [0].

  However, the Open vSwitch `ovsdb-server` process does not appear to
  update its perspective of which protocol versions it should support
  until it is restarted:

  # ovs-ofctl -O OpenFlow14 dump-flows br-int
  2019-11-12T12:52:56Z|00001|vconn|WARN|unix:/var/run/openvswitch/br-int.mgmt: version negotiation failed (we support version 0x05, peer supports version 0x01)
  ovs-ofctl: br-int: failed to connect to socket (Broken pipe)

  # systemctl restart ovsdb-server 
  # ovs-ofctl -O OpenFlow14 dump-flows br-int
   cookie=0x84ead4b79da3289a, duration=1.576s, table=0, n_packets=0, n_bytes=0, priority=65535,vlan_tci=0x0fff/0x1fff actions=drop
   cookie=0x84ead4b79da3289a, duration=1.352s, table=0, n_packets=0, n_bytes=0, priority=5,in_port="int-br-ex",dl_dst=fa:16:3f:69:2e:c6 actions=goto_table:4
  ...
  (Success)
